Introduction: The Age of Personal Sound

Few inventions have reshaped everyday behavior as quietly — and as profoundly — as headphones. Once accessories for music lovers, they have evolved into essential tools of modern life. People work, relax, commute, exercise, socialize, and even emotionally regulate themselves through private audio environments.

Yet headphones now sit at the center of a fascinating contradiction.

On one side, society increasingly demands their use in shared spaces. Airlines, trains, and buses expect passengers to keep their sound private. In early 2026, this expectation reached a new level when United Airlines updated passenger rules to explicitly require headphones when listening to personal devices — with potential removal from flights for noncompliance.

On the other side, scientific research warns that headphones may disconnect individuals from their environment, contributing to pedestrian injuries and deaths. A widely cited study reported that serious accidents involving headphone-wearing pedestrians more than tripled over six years, often because victims failed to hear warning sounds such as horns or trains.

This paradox reveals something deeper than etiquette or safety. It exposes a central tension of modern urban life:

We want privacy inside shared space — but survival still depends on awareness of others.

Understanding when to use headphones — and when not — has therefore become a social skill, not merely a personal choice.

2. The Etiquette Crisis in Public Transport

Public transport historically required implicit cooperation. Silence, courtesy, and spatial awareness allowed strangers to coexist peacefully.

Smartphones disrupted that balance.

Passengers began playing videos, TikTok clips, or conducting loud speakerphone conversations in enclosed spaces. Unlike conversations — which involve social reciprocity — device audio imposes one person’s entertainment onto everyone else.

This triggered widespread frustration across cities worldwide.

Airlines became a turning point.

In 2026, United Airlines updated its contract of carriage to require passengers to wear headphones when consuming media. Violators could be denied boarding or removed from flights.

The policy formalized what had previously been an unwritten rule:
personal audio must remain personal.

The motivation was practical:

  • Aircraft cabins amplify noise stress.

  • Passengers cannot leave the environment.

  • Conflicts escalate quickly in confined spaces.

The airline’s move reflected growing recognition that unmanaged digital behavior disrupts collective comfort.

Interestingly, public reaction was largely positive — suggesting society already agreed on the norm before institutions enforced it.

3. Why Speaker Audio Feels So Disruptive

The strong emotional response to speaker audio is not accidental.

Human brains are wired to prioritize unpredictable sound. Sudden speech fragments, laughter, or music changes trigger involuntary attention shifts. Psychologists call this the orienting response — a survival mechanism evolved to detect threats.

When someone plays audio aloud:

  • Others cannot predict rhythm or volume.

  • Attention is repeatedly hijacked.

  • Cognitive fatigue increases.

Unlike background noise, media audio carries semantic meaning — words and melodies compete directly with thought processes.

Headphones solve this problem by restoring control over attention boundaries.

Thus, etiquette expectations emerged naturally:

Headphones are not merely polite; they protect shared cognitive space.

4. The Scientific Warning: When Headphones Become Dangerous

Yet the same device that protects social harmony may reduce physical safety.

A study summarized by ScienceDaily found that injuries and deaths among headphone-wearing pedestrians increased sharply between 2004 and 2011. In many incidents, warning sounds were present but unheard.

Researchers identified two primary mechanisms:

1. Sensory Deprivation

Headphones mask environmental audio cues:

  • approaching vehicles

  • bicycle bells

  • emergency sirens

  • shouted warnings

In nearly a third of documented accidents, horns or alarms sounded before impact.

2. Cognitive Distraction

Listening engages attention systems, reducing situational awareness — a phenomenon linked to “inattentional blindness.”

Even when users technically hear surrounding noise, their brains process it less effectively.

This creates a dangerous illusion:
feeling aware while actually being less aware.

5. The Psychology of Distracted Walking

Modern cities increasingly face what researchers call distracted mobility.

Studies show pedestrians listening to music or interacting with devices display:

  • slower reaction times

  • reduced scanning behavior

  • riskier street crossings

  • delayed responses to hazards

The brain has limited attentional bandwidth. When part of it processes audio narratives or rhythms, fewer resources remain for spatial monitoring.

Urban planners once worried primarily about distracted drivers. Today, pedestrians themselves represent a growing safety concern.

The paradox becomes clear:

  • Without headphones → social disturbance.

  • With headphones → potential safety risk.

The solution therefore cannot be absolute rules.

It must be context awareness.

6. When You SHOULD Use Headphones

✔ Enclosed Shared Spaces

Examples:

  • airplanes

  • trains

  • buses

  • waiting rooms

  • libraries

  • cafés with close seating

In these environments:

  • Others cannot escape sound.

  • Noise accumulates quickly.

  • Social cooperation is required.

Headphones here function as social infrastructure, similar to speaking quietly or respecting personal space.

The United Airlines rule simply formalizes an emerging global etiquette norm.

✔ Controlled Movement Environments

Safe contexts include:

  • sitting or stationary waiting

  • indoor walking spaces

  • quiet parks away from traffic

  • exercise machines in gyms

Risk remains low because environmental hazards are limited.

✔ Noise Management Situations

Headphones also serve mental health functions:

  • reducing sensory overload

  • supporting focus during work

  • managing anxiety during commuting

Used thoughtfully, they enhance well-being without harming others.

7. When You SHOULD NOT Use Headphones (or Modify Use)

⚠ Crossing Streets or Near Traffic

Research consistently shows increased crash probability among distracted pedestrians.

Best practice:

  • remove one earbud

  • pause audio

  • lower volume before crossings

⚠ Cycling or Micro-Mobility

E-scooters and bicycles require rapid auditory awareness. Sound often provides earlier warnings than vision.

⚠ High-Risk Urban Environments

Examples:

  • railway platforms

  • construction zones

  • crowded intersections

  • emergency situations

In these settings, environmental audio is a safety system.

⚠ Night Walking Alone

Auditory awareness contributes to personal security and situational judgment.

8. Technology’s Attempted Solutions

Technology itself now attempts to resolve the contradiction it created.

Emerging innovations include:

  • transparency or “ambient” audio modes

  • bone-conduction headphones

  • AI hazard detection systems

  • adaptive volume control

Researchers even explore smart headphones capable of detecting approaching vehicles and issuing alerts.

The future may not require choosing between etiquette and safety — devices may dynamically balance both.
